[发明专利]一种基于流量预测的卫星网络队列管理方法有效
| 申请号: | 202110752131.5 | 申请日: | 2021-06-30 |
| 公开(公告)号: | CN113472427B | 公开(公告)日: | 2022-07-15 |
| 发明(设计)人: | 别玉霞;李芷含;胡智;王宇鹏 | 申请(专利权)人: | 沈阳航空航天大学 |
| 主分类号: | H04B7/185 | 分类号: | H04B7/185;H04L41/147;H04L41/142;H04L47/10;G06F30/25 |
| 代理公司: | 沈阳东大知识产权代理有限公司 21109 | 代理人: | 李在川 |
| 地址: | 110136 辽宁省沈*** | 国省代码: | 辽宁;21 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 流量 预测 卫星网络 队列 管理 方法 | ||
本发明提供一种基于流量预测的卫星网络队列管理方法,构建动态三次指数平滑模型,将具有自相似性的流量数据作为动态三次指数平滑模型的输入,利用差分进化算法优化动态三次指数平滑模型中的平滑系数,将最优平滑系数对应的动态三次指数平滑模型作为预测模型,利用三次曲线函数对ARED算法的包丢弃概率函数进行平滑的非线性处理,通过ARED算法输出包丢弃概率用于控制传输信道中的丢包率、吞吐量、平均队列长度,本发明方法提高了流量预测的精度,还为网络拥塞控制提供充足的时间,利用非线性的包丢弃概率函数改进ARED算法可以有效控制队列长度的同时解决RED的参数敏感性问题,使信道传输更加稳定。
技术领域
本发明属于卫星网络通信技术领域,具体涉及一种基于流量预测的卫星网络队列管理方法。
背景技术
时间序列模型是应用最广泛的流量预测模型,分为移动平均模型、平稳时间序列模型和指数平滑模型。其中,时间序列中的指数平滑模型最早由CC.Holt于1958年提出,原理是任一期的指数平滑值都是本期实际观察值与前一期指数平滑值的加权平均,利用修匀技术,削弱短期随机波动对序列的影响,使序列平滑化,从而获得时间序列平滑值,作为未来短期内的预测参数。该算法是生产预测中利用最广泛的一种方法,也用于中短期经济发展趋势预测。
指数平滑模型具有不同的平滑次数,其中三次指数平滑(Holt-Winter)预测模型主要针对时间序列中的非线性趋势进行修正,能够适应卫星网络流量的非线性、自相似性和长相关性变化趋势。Holt-Winter算法包括三个平滑方程和一个预测方程,对各期观测值依时间顺序进行加权平均,其结果作为流量预测值,表现出历史数据对未来值的影响随时间而递减的特征。传统三次指数平滑模型的平滑系数α是固定值,该模型主要应用于稳定的数据模型,在中长期数据预测中,当数据变化较大时,无法及时调整,导致预测误差变大。为此,有学者对传统的三次指数平滑法做了改进,提出了动态三次指数平滑预测模型。动态三次指数平滑法是在传统算法的基础上提出动态平滑系数,并采用迭代的方式对参数进行更新。该算法在复杂数据的中长期预测中可减小预测误差,具有更好的稳定性。
典型的队列管理模型有随机早期检测(Random Early Detection,RED),和自适应随机早期检测(Adaptive Random Early Detection,ARED)等。RED队列管理方法中参数设置敏感度较高,包丢弃概率为线性函数,丢包速率过快容易造成队列振荡,信道利用率过低;ARED队列管理方法实现了参数的自动调节,但是ARED中包丢弃概率函数仍为线性,线性增长速率过快容易导致队列振荡。
发明内容
针对现有技术的不足,本发明引入三次曲线函数对ARED算法进行改进,能有效降低丢包率,提高平均队列长度,提高信道利用率。为此,本发明提出一种基于流量预测的卫星网络队列管理方法,适用于具有自相似特性的卫星网络业务流量,包括:
步骤1:对卫星网络中一段时间内的流量数据进行自相似性判断;具体表述为:采用重标极差R/S分析法估算流量数据的Hurst指数H,如果H∈(0.5,1),说明所述流量数据具有自相似性;
步骤2:将具有自相似性的流量数据作为动态三次指数平滑模型的输入,结合动态三次指数平滑模型和ARED算法得到包丢弃概率;
步骤3:通过得到的包丢弃概率控制传输信道中的丢包率、吞吐量、平均队列长度。
所述步骤2包括:
步骤2.1:构建动态三次指数平滑模型,将具有自相似性的流量数据作为动态三次指数平滑模型的输入,利用差分进化算法优化动态三次指数平滑模型中的平滑系数,得到一个平滑系数的最优解;
步骤2.2:将平滑系数最优解对应的动态三次指数平滑模型作为最优预测模型,将最优预测模型输出的流量数据的预测值作为ARED算法的输入;
步骤2.3:利用三次曲线函数对ARED算法的包丢弃概率函数进行平滑的非线性处理,通过ARED算法输出包丢弃概率。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于沈阳航空航天大学,未经沈阳航空航天大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202110752131.5/2.html,转载请声明来源钻瓜专利网。





